Afrika Eye 2019: Girlhood + poetry & discussion

Director
Céline Sciamma
Certificate
15
Running Time
110 mins

French director Céline Sciamma followed her provocative, sensitively directed gender identity drama Tomboy with another sharply observed character study.

This time, the focus is on Marieme (newcomer Karidja Toure), a black teenager from grim, dead-end La Haine territory, who joins a girl gang in search of freedom and a better life. Go here for our full review.

Curated by Asmaa Jama, this Afrika Eye event includes a screening of the short film Nuraiyah from Bristol-based Kehvyn Ishmail and poetry by Muneera Pilgrim.
